NAT-RG1000 Top of Rail Friction Modifier

NAT-RG1000 Top of Rail Friction Modifier

A unique patented nanotechnology friction modifier designed for on-board and trackside rail top applications. Controls friction coefficient to an optimal 0.3–0.4 range, reduces wear, noise, and lubricant consumption, while being water-resistant and easy to pump.

NAT-R3001 Rail Curve Grease

NAT-R3001 Rail Curve Grease

High-performance biodegradable rail curve grease with calcium sulfonate complex thickener. Provides superior carry-down, gauge face coating, and wear protection at temperatures exceeding 80°C. Noise-reducing, adhesive, and cohesive — ideal for ecologically sensitive areas.

NAT-1026 Wheel Flange Grease

NAT-1026 Wheel Flange Grease

Heavy-duty calcium sulfonate complex grease designed for on-board rail curve and wheel flange lubrication. Features excellent extreme pressure, adhesion, low friction, soluble Moly for extended service life, and a wide operating range from -30°C to 150°C.
